使用kso​​ap2发送复杂对象

时间:2012-11-05 09:19:56

标签: android

我正在建立一个移动网络应用程序。我有一个Web服务(WCF)和一个Android客户端。我使用KSOAP2发送和接收消息。所以我只需要发送简单的蜇和整数但响应是一个复杂对象的数组,所以我需要使用这个有用的link来正确地解析它。我现在需要做的是相反的,我需要发送一个这样的复杂对象:

public Class OutterObject{
       int a;
       String b;
       InnerObject c;
}

现在InnerObject也有两个对象作为字段。所以它有点复杂。我不知道我应该做什么,我有一些关于编组的文章,但我不知道是否这是正确的方法,因为我看过其他文章没有使用编组。你能指出我正确的方向吗?或者分享如何使用kso​​ap2发送复杂对象的指南。 谢谢你的时间。

1 个答案:

答案 0 :(得分:0)

http://code.google.com/p/ksoap2-android/wiki/CodingTipsAndTricks#sending/receiving_array_of_complex_types_or_primitives 以上链接告诉您如何发送复杂对象。 我还为ksoap2或其他客户端找到了一些存根生成器。但除了wsclient ++之外,没有人可以翻译复杂的对象。但是,wsclient ++不是免费的。